Aware, Inc. (NASDAQ:AWRE – Get Free Report) was the target of a significant decline in short interest in December. As of December 31st, there was short interest totaling 28,973 shares, a decline of 41.4% from the December 15th total of 49,402 shares. Approximately 0.2% of the company’s shares are sold short. Based on an average trading volume of 33,746 shares, the short-interest ratio is presently 0.9 days. Aware Company Profile
Aware, Inc is a technology company specializing in biometric software and image processing solutions. Its core offerings include fingerprint, face and iris recognition algorithms, biometric template management, and mobile enrolment tools designed to capture and verify identities in secure environments. The company’s software development kits (SDKs) and web services APIs enable system integrators, device manufacturers and application developers to embed biometric and forensic capabilities into their products and services.
Founded in 1986 and headquartered in Bedford, Massachusetts, Aware evolved from an imaging technology provider into a leading vendor of biometric software.
